Abstract
We have recently reported that (nitronyl nitroxide)-substituted dihydrophenazine radical cations exhibit interesting magnetic properties. For further development of this system, we have designed and synthesized a neutral dihydrophenazine derivative with two nitronyl nitroxides at 2,7-positions and its oxidized cationic species. We clarified 1) the neutral diradical species shows a weak ferromagnetic interaction between the two nitronyl nitroxides, 2) the cationic species exhibits a strong ferromagnetic interaction between the dihydrophenazine radical cation and the two nitronyl nitroxides. The structures and properties of these species will be described.
